> One somewhat serious problem is that whenever I let up on the
> accelerator quickly it dies.  I thought it might be the idle.  It was
> kind of low, but not much (800).  I increased it to 850 and it still
> happens.

If this is your AT, then set the idle to 950. You've got your timing set to 
TDC, right?
